having been a toolmaker since 1956, my knowledge of dowel pins is that they are case hardened and ground on the outside but soft in the center. people that I have seen use them, they always broke, sometimes sitting on the ramp. grade 8 bolts work well by cutting off the head and threads. the very best thing is a shackel pin from Aircraft Spruce and cut off the head with carborundum wheel as they are too hard to saw. just my humble opinion.
